Output 20f6ec45833e3b9283048191e782642d33010b8a372207c977277c9283778414:19

value
632214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6414d6ea79567e64d666adebcd5a4a52046d46 OP_EQUAL
address
3QcFRUGwQfVhRpu28RC2FeV7WLSTULp1jB
transaction
20f6ec45833e3b9283048191e782642d33010b8a372207c977277c9283778414
spent
true